Pre-Operative Prep work



Before going through cataract surgery, your optometrist will provide you with detailed directions for pre-operative prep work. These instructions might consist of guidelines on fasting before the surgery, as well as details on any kind of medications you need to readjust or continue taking. It's important to follow these guidelines thoroughly to make certain the procedure goes efficiently and your recuperation succeeds.

In addition, your doctor may suggest you to arrange for transport to and from the surgical facility, as you will not have the ability to drive instantly after the procedure. See to it to have a liable adult accompany you on the day of surgery to provide assistance and support.

In many cases, you might require to undertake specific pre-operative examinations to examine your eye wellness and make sure the surgery can continue as planned. Procedure Summary



When undertaking cataract surgery, the operation commonly involves eliminating the gloomy lens and replacing it with a clear fabricated lens to bring back vision. This treatment is performed under neighborhood anesthesia, indicating you'll be conscious however your eye will certainly be numbed to stop any type of pain.

The surgeon will make a little cut in your eye and use ultrasound technology to break up the gloomy lens, which is then delicately sucked out. As soon as the cataract is removed, an intraocular lens (IOL) is inserted into the exact same pill that held your all-natural lens. This IOL stays in place completely and does not need any type of upkeep.

The whole surgical procedure typically takes about 15-30 minutes per eye, and you can typically go home the very same day. It's important to follow your surgeon's post-operative guidelines very carefully to ensure proper healing and ideal visual outcomes.

Post-Operative Recovery



After cataract surgical treatment, you'll be recommended on exactly how to take care of your eye throughout the post-operative healing duration. It's crucial to adhere to these instructions faithfully to ensure a smooth healing process. Your eye might be covered with a protective guard or patch quickly after the surgical treatment to prevent any type of unintentional massaging or stress on the operated eye. You may likewise need to use recommended eye drops to help in healing and protect against infection.

Throughout the preliminary recuperation duration, you may experience some light discomfort, itching, or watering of the eye, which is normal. It's essential to prevent exhausting activities, bending over, or lifting hefty objects to protect against any kind of strain on the eye. You need to additionally participate in follow-up consultations with your eye cosmetic surgeon to monitor your progression and attend to any worries.

As your eye remains to heal over the following weeks, your vision will gradually enhance. It's necessary to be patient throughout this recuperation duration and enable your eye to completely heal before resuming regular tasks. If you experience any type of sudden changes in vision, serious discomfort, or various other worrying signs and symptoms, call your eye surgeon promptly for further analysis.
